The Benefits Behind the Chemical

When this chemical was first discovered in 1940, it was believed to not have and pharmaceutical qualities. Now, scientists have seen that the effects of Cannabidiol products range across several health issues. These include; Parkinson’s disease, schizophrenia, seizures, dystonia, anxiety and bipolar disorder. This chemical has also been used to aid in stopping smoking and the treatment of multiple sclerosis. Traditionally, it is taken by mouth or inhaled. The route of administration is determined by the prescribing healthcare provider. You may ask is hemp extract easy on the stomach? Yes, another benefit.

Medicine and Herbal Supplements that Interacts with CBD

There are medicines that will interact with CBD and therefore it’s important to consult with your healthcare provider before using such products. Some of the medicines and that will interact with Cannabidiol are; depression medications, medicine that changes the liver, fentanyl, propofol, morphine, benzodiazepines and CNS9 central nervous system) depressants. Herbal supplements that will interact with CBD include but are not limited to; catnip, Jamaican dogwood, skullcap, sage, St. John’s Wart, melatonin and California poppy.
